Quebec television personality and weather presenter Nadège St-Philippe died Saturday, after a battle with cancer.
She had been with TVA Nouvelles since 2006, owned a jewelry line and also worked as a fitness coach.
“There are very few words to express the sadness we feel, Nadège will leave a very big void. We are losing a colleague who is very dear to us, but also a friend of the big family of TVA,” reads a statement.
She was first diagnosed with stage three colorectal cancer in 2011.
In the fall of 2021, her doctor contacted her to tell her that a polyp that had been removed was cancerous.
In a March Instagram post, Nadège shared the news: “On December 1, I had to stop everything and on January 1, 2022, I received my first dose of chemotherapy. I am starting to get back. Since February 18, I am making a gradual return to my professional activities that I love.”
Adding that she hoped to be back on television within six months.
Many took to social media to express their condolences.
“What sad news. This is a talented young woman who is leaving us much too soon. My thoughts are with the family of Nadège today. My deep and sincere condolences to all her relatives,” wrote Montreal Mayor Valérie Plante.
